    My question involves vehicle registration or title in the state of: Florida

    I was given a old boat trailer a few years ago and it has been sitting on the side of my house since then.

    The guy I got it from could not find the title or even a copy of registration at the time and he has since moved out of the area and I cannot locate him.

    I want to use the trailer, but have no idea how to get it registered.

    What do I need to do?

    In most states you can get the trailer wieghed. This has to be done at a certified scale. Then take the wieght slip into the DMV office, then have it registered as a home built trailer.

    Just go to the DMV office and ask them what you need to do. Usually they have the packets that contain the info.
